Working philosophy


The project is structured into four work packages (coordination, hydromorphology, ecology and sociology). Based on the different scientific backgrounds of the partners an interdisciplinary approach is guaranteed. First, within the individual work packages the sectoral analysis of the efficiency of preservation and restoration of river floodplains is performed. Secondly, the sectoral results are integrated to formulate an interdisciplinary floodplain evaluation methodology.

The major exploitation of PRO_Floodplain’s results will be a generally understandable description of the effectiveness of flood risk reduction by river floodplain preservation and restoration.
